News 

          Shortly after assuming office, Secretary of State Hillary Rodham Clinton decided to give high 
          priority to USA participation in the Shanghai World Expo.    In addition to sending letters of 
          endorsement to a number of leading US‐China trade organizations, Secretary Clinton has 
          assembled a group of senior State Department officials who are actively supporting the USA 
          National Pavilion team's planning and public outreach efforts.    Thank you, Madam Secretary!   

          GE has joined the USA National Pavilion effort as a Founding Sponsor.    GE will prominently 
          showcase its “Ecomagination” initiative in the Pavilion through an array of environmentally 
          friendly products in the categories of energy generation, water treatment, lighting and electrical 
          distribution systems, security systems, medical diagnostic imaging, and locomotive and aircraft 
          engines.    With this announcement, GE joins our ever‐growing group of sponsors, which to date 
          includes 3M, Dell, and the USA‐China Education, Science & Culture Association.

Events 

          Nick Winslow and Norm Elder met with the new Consul ‐General of China in Los Angeles, CA     
          on May 6 to discuss preparations for the USA National Pavilion. 

          Former U.S. Consul‐General in Shanghai General Ken Jarrett made a presentation about the USA 
          National Pavilion to the American Chamber of Commerce in Beijing on May 7. 

          U.S Consul‐General Bea Camp and Expo Deputy Director Zhou Hanmin joined Ellen Eliasoph and 
          Frank Lavin in Shanghai on April 24 for a USA National Pavilion briefing for a small group of 
          senior US corporate executives.

The Pavilion 

        Our design team is including the latest green technologies and materials in the Pavilion.     

        The Pavilion will feature an organic garden on its roof, and the garden’s produce will help supply 
        the fine dining facility in the Pavilion’s VIP lounge.
